Frequently asked questions

About Shelby County East Middle School
How many students attend Shelby County East Middle School?
Shelby County East Middle School enrolls approximately 552 students in grades 06-08.
Is Shelby County East Middle School an elementary, middle, or high school?
Shelby County East Middle School is a middle school covering grades 06-08.
How many teachers does Shelby County East Middle School have?
Shelby County East Middle School employs 32 FTE teachers, for a student-to-teacher ratio of 17.2:1.
What is the racial breakdown of students at Shelby County East Middle School?
At Shelby County East Middle School, the student body is approximately 73% White, 17% Hispanic, 5% Black, 1% Asian, 5% Two or more.
